Trainee Technical Support Representative, Contract

Trainee Technical Support Representative

Job Location - Bangalore/Hyderabad: Remote

Role Type - Contract (3 months to start with, extension depends on Business requirement and Performance)
Experience - 1 to 6 years
Mandatory Experience - 1 year of International email experience


What you'll be doing:

  • Responding promptly to customer queries in a timely and accurate manner via email and/or live chat.
  • Queries can be of a technical & non-technical nature.
  • Acknowledging and resolving customer complaints & determining the cause of the problem, expediting correction or adjustment, and following up to ensure resolution.
  • Explain and guide customers through product features and functionalities.
  • Stay up to date and be thorough with product knowledge so that customer questions can be answered quickly.
  • Communicating, coordinating & collaborating with team members and colleagues to provide customers with best possible solution to their problem

What we're looking for:

  • Candidates with international customer support experience in voice, email and chat.
  • Candidates who can adapt to customer issues relying on product knowledge as well as their presence of mind.
  • Maintain our reputation as a company that offers excellent customer service at every interaction with the customer.
  • Stay focused on the quality by ensuring consistency and adherence to high standards.
  • Candidate must be willing to work in any shift and shouldn't have a problem with rotational week offs.

Must have:

  • Candidate must have their own computer with Windows 8.1 or above.
  • Mandatory hi-speed broadband connection.
  • UPS/power backup solution if possible.
  • Outstation candidates should be willing to relocate to Hyderabad/Bangalore when work from office resumes.

Mandatory Skills:

  • Proficient with English and have good written & verbal communication skills.
  • Flexibility & availability for rotational shifts and week offs to cover hours of operations.
  • Must possess logical, reasoning, and problem-solving skills.
